Abstract
A three-dimensional Cd(II) complex [Cd(L)(BPDC)]-3H2O (1) (L = 3,5-di(1H-benzimidazol-1-yl)pyridine, H2BPDC = biphenyl-4,4-dicarboxylic acid) is synthesized and characterized using single crystal X-ray diffraction, IR spectroscopy, and elemental analysis. The single crystal X-ray diffraction analysis reveals that complex 1 is a novel twofold interpenetrating 4-connected net with a (65·8) topology. Moreover, complex 1 exhibits an emission band at 400 nm with an inconspicuous shoulder at 525 nm (λex = 329 nm).
